Description: | For the opening event in our Autumn 2019 season we have: Alastair Lichten, Head of Education at the National Secular Society (NSS). His subject is "No more faith schools: towards a secular education system". Faith schools are the biggest example of religious privilege in our education system. From faith schools to coercive worship, and from confessional RE to faith based sex education, our school system is full of inappropriate religious influence, privilege and discrimination. But it doesn’t need to be this way, our many fantastic community schools show how we can move towards a secular, inclusive education system. The National Secular Society’s head of education, Alastair Lichten, will talk about the range of the Society’s campaigning, policy and advice work on education, including their No More Faith Schools campaign.
